Nov 20, 2018

Rod Stryker

Radically Loved Podcast

 

Rod Stryker is a world-renowned yoga and meditation teacher, author and creator of the most comprehensive online yoga teacher training in the world. He is also my teacher!

 

Rod has spent the last forty years teaching the practices of yoga, meditation and yoga nidra around the world. He works one on one with clients, helping them find and keep enlightenment, as well as corporations, introducing them to the holistic methods to provide healthy, thriving work spaces.

 

I work closely with Rod as his student and find myself constantly mesmerized by his tight tie to his inner knowing. Spending hours with him reminds me that we are humans interacting with each other, and it is up to each individual to be the light we choose to spread throughout the world through our interactions.

 

In this episode of Radically Loved, Rod and I talk about how technology is affecting our brain chemistry and why we find ourselves so addicted to Netflix and our cellphones. We discuss yoga nidra and how it is the most powerful form of sleep and meditation available. Lastly, Rod explains how to identify unhappiness and where to begin in shifting into a space of happiness and fulfillment.

More About Our Guest

 

Rod Stryker is a yoga and meditation teacher. He has spent forty years teaching individuals and companies how to cultivate yoga practices and meditation techniques into their daily lives. He is also the author of The Four Desires: Creating a Life of Purpose, Happiness, Prosperity, and Freedom. Rod has recently launched his app, Sanctuary, to help people around the world become masters of meditation and yoga nidra. Learn more at rodstryker.com
